7 Talent Acquisition Manager Job Description Templates and Examples

Talent Acquisition Managers are responsible for overseeing the recruitment process to attract, hire, and retain top talent for an organization. They collaborate with hiring managers, develop recruitment strategies, and ensure a positive candidate experience. Junior roles focus on sourcing and screening candidates, while senior roles involve strategic planning, team leadership, and aligning recruitment efforts with organizational goals.

1. Talent Acquisition Specialist Job Description Template

Company Overview

[$COMPANY_OVERVIEW]

Role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led Talent Acquisition Specialist to join our dynamic HR team. In this role, you will be responsible for attracting top-tier talent and driving the recruitment process for various positions across the organization. Your expertise in sourcing, interviewing, and hiring will play a critical role in building a diverse and high-performing workforce.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ement effective recruitment strategies to attract a diverse pool of candidates
  • Utilize various sourcing methods, including job boards, social media, networking, and employee referrals to identify and engage potential candidates
  • Conduct in-depth interviews and assessments to evaluate candidate qualifications and cultural fit
  • Collaborate with hiring managers to understand their staffing needs and provide guidance on the recruitment process
  • Manage the full-cycle recruitment process, from job posting to offer negotiation and onboarding
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records in the applicant tracking system (ATS)
  • Track and analyze recruitment metrics to continuously improve the hiring process and candidate experience

Required and Preferred Qualifications

Required:

  •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field
  • 3+ years of experience in talent acquisition or recruitment, preferably in a fast-paced environment
  • Proven track record of successfully filling positions at various levels, from entry-level to executive roles
  • Strong understanding of recruitment best practices and employment laws

Preferred:

  • Experience with HR software and applicant tracking systems (ATS)
  • Knowledge of diversity and inclusion best practices in recruitment
  • Relevant HR certifications (e.g., SHRM-CP, PHR) are a plus

Technical Skills and Relevant Technologies

  • Proficiency in using recruitment platforms and tools such as LinkedIn Recruiter, Indeed, and various ATS systems
  • Familiarity with HR metrics and reporting tools to measure recruitment effectiveness
  • Ability to leverage social media for recruitment purposes

Soft Skills and Cultural Fit

  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ships with candidates and hiring managers
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ail, with the ability to manage multiple recruitment processes simultaneously
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fully remote environment
  • Demonstrated commitment to promoting diversity and inclusion within the workplace

3. Talent Acquisition Manager Job Description Template

Company Overview

[$COMPANY_OVERVIEW]

Role Overview

We are seeking a strategic and results-oriented Talent Acquisition Manager to join our team at [$COMPANY_NAME]. In this pivotal role, you will lead the talent acquisition strategy, drive recruitment initiatives, and enhance our employer brand to attract top-tier candidates. You will collaborate closely with leadership and hiring managers to understand workforce needs and implement innovative sourcing strategies that align with our business objectives.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ute a comprehensive talent acquisition strategy to meet current and future hiring needs
  • Lead and mentor a team of recruiters, fostering a culture of high performance and continuous improvement
  • Partner with hiring managers to define job requirements and create compelling job descriptions that resonate with potential candidates
  • Utilize data-driven approaches to assess recruitment metrics and identify areas for improvement
  • Implement innovative sourcing techniques, including social media, networking, and employee referrals, to build a robust talent pipeline
  • Enhance the candidate experience through effective communication and timely feedback throughout the recruitment process
  • Conduct regular market research and stay updated on industry trends to inform recruitment strategies
  • Collaborate with the HR team to ensure a seamless onboarding process for new hires

Required and Preferred Qualifications

Required:

  • 5+ years of experience in talent acquisition, with a proven track record of successfully filling roles across various functions
  • Strong understanding of recruitment best practices, tools, and technologies
  • Experience managing and developing a team of recruiters
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ships at all levels of the organization

Preferred:

  • Experience in a fast-paced, high-growth environment
  • Famil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S) and recruitment analytics
  • Professional certification in HR or recruitment (e.g., SHRM-CP, AIRS, etc.)

Technical Skills and Relevant Technologies

  • Proficiency in leveraging recruitment software and ATS to streamline hiring processes
  • Strong knowledge of social media recruiting and digital employer branding
  • Ability to analyze recruitment data and metrics to drive strategic decisions

Soft Skills and Cultural Fit

  • Strong leadership skills with a hands-on approach to mentoring and development
  • Proactive and adaptable mindset, thriving in a dynamic environment
  • High level of emotional intelligence and the ability to connect with diverse candidates
  • A deep commitment to fostering an inclusive and diverse workplace
